How much does it cost to move from New Orleans, LA to Tennessee?

Here are average prices of hire a moving company, rent a moving container, or rent a moving truck when moving from New Orleans to Tennessee:

Move size Moving company Moving container Rental truck
Studio / 1 Bedroom $1,285 - $3,626 $780 - $1,934 $481 - $936
2 - 3 bedrooms $2,255 - $6,311 $1,452 - $2,696 $502 - $1,015
4+ bedrooms $4,189 - $9,051 $1,913 - $3,676 $664 - $1,287

*These price ranges are a rough estimate based on 500 miles and historical averages. The actual size of your move, additional services required, truck parking access, market conditions, and availability can greatly affect the final cost of your move.

The cost to move from New Orleans, LA to Tennessee will depend on:

  • Move size: The amount of items you have — as well as your home size and layout — will impact the total cost of your relocation.
  • Time of year: Summer is peak moving season in New Orleans, so moving companies will likely charge more.
  • DIY vs. professional mover: DIY moving services are usually cheaper but involve more work and stress compared to hiring the pros.

How much does it cost to hire movers from New Orleans, LA to Tennessee?

Hiring movers for a studio apartment or one-bedroom home from New Orleans to Tennessee will cost between $1,285 to $3,626. The cost to move a two- to three-bedroom home from New Orleans to TN will range from $2,255 to $6,311, and a large move from New Orleans to Tennessee will cost from $4,189 to $9,051.

How much are moving containers like PODS from New Orleans, LA to Tennessee?

Moving pods from New Orleans to Tennessee will cost you $780 to $1,934. For a two- to three-bedroom move, moving containers can cost $1,452 to $2,696. A four-bedroom move or bigger will cost $1,913 to $3,676. Learn more about PODS cost.

How much is a moving truck from New Orleans, LA to Tennessee?

A moving rental truck is generally the cheapest option, but it requires you to do all of the driving and labor.

Moving a studio or one-bedroom apartment in a rental truck will cost around $481 to $936. A larger move will cost $502 to $1,015, and a four-bedroom or bigger move from New Orleans to Tennessee costs from $664 to $1,287.

Considerations for moving to Tennessee

  • Weather: Most of Tennessee has hot and humid summers and cool to mild winters, with the exception of some of the higher elevations in the Appalachians, which has mild summers and cool winters. The state averages about 15 tornadoes a year..
  • HOA rules: Check ahead with any neighborhood or community rules on moving to ensure a smooth move.
  • Elevator reservation: If your building has an elevator you’ll want to check on how to reserve it for move day.
  • Truck parking permits: Some cities require parking permits for large vehicles and moving trucks. Find out if you need any parking permits ahead of time.
  • State licensing: Although a local license is not required in Tennessee, make sure the moving company you’ll be hiring is registered with U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T). To verify if you’re dealing with a legal and licensed mover, you may ask them their USDOT registration number. Make sure the moving company you use has a license before hiring.
  • State regulator: You can verify a Tennessee moving license and its status on the state regulator's official website.
  • Moving permits: Tennessee does not require any moving permits, but it is helpful to check local parking restrictions before moving into the state.
  • Change of address: We recommend submitting your change of address form with USPS at least a week prior to your move. You can set an official move date on the form and this way all of your mail will get properly forward to Tennessee. Get started here.
  • Mover's insurance: Every state has their own requirements when it comes to insurance. When it comes to movers' insurance in Tennessee, most moving companies offer Released Value Protection at no extra charge. This basic coverage extends to 60 cents per pound per item. For increased protection, consider discussing Full Value Protection options with the moving company. Additionally, exploring third-party insurance providers is a viable choice for tailored plans. Prioritize understanding coverage limits, potential extra costs, and read reviews to make an informed decision about your moving insurance in Tennessee.
